What Is a Plumbing Emergency?
Let’s start with the basics. A plumbing emergency is any sudden problem that threatens your home, health, or safety and needs immediate attention to prevent major damage. It’s not a slow drip you can catch with a bucket. It’s a crisis that can’t wait until Monday morning.
In Woodstock, with our mix of historic colonial homes and newer builds, emergencies often look like this:
- Burst or Frozen Pipes: During heavy winter freezes in Woodstock, temperatures can plunge well below freezing. Pipes in unheated crawlspaces or along exterior walls in older homes near Roseland Park can freeze and burst, sending water everywhere.
- Sewer Line Backups: Heavy spring rains or autumn storms can overwhelm septic systems or town lines, especially in areas with mature tree roots. If multiple drains are gurgling or sewage is coming up into basement floor drains, that’s a major emergency.
- Major Water Leaks: A broken water heater, a failed pressure valve, or a cracked supply line can flood a room in minutes. This is especially damaging in homes with finished basements.
- Complete Loss of Water: If your well pump fails or a main line breaks, having no water is a health and safety issue.
- Gas Line Issues: If you smell gas (like rotten eggs) near an appliance or hear a hissing sound, leave the house immediately and call for help from a safe distance.
If you’re asking, "Is this an emergency?" a good rule is: If it’s causing significant water damage, risk of mold, or is a health hazard, it is. Don’t wait.

Understanding the Cost of an Emergency Plumber in Woodstock
This is the big question: "How much does an emergency plumber cost?" Let’s be honest. Emergency services cost more than a scheduled appointment. You’re paying for immediate response, expert skill at any hour, and the peace of mind that the damage will stop.
Here’s a typical cost breakdown for an emergency plumber in Woodstock, CT:
- Emergency Call-Out/Service Fee: This is a flat fee for the urgent dispatch, travel, and after-hours service. In our region, this typically ranges from $100 to $250. This is the "how much is an emergency plumber call-out" fee.
- Hourly Labor Rates: After-hours labor rates are higher. Expect rates between $150 and $300 per hour, depending on the time (nights, weekends, holidays are highest).
- Parts & Materials: This is the cost of any new pipes, fittings, valves, etc. In Woodstock, we often work with PEX (for modern repipes), copper, and PVC. The cost varies by job.
So, are emergency plumbers more expensive? Yes, due to the premium for immediate service. A common job like fixing a burst pipe in a crawlspace might have a total cost (call-out + 2-3 hours labor + materials) in the range of $500-$1,200. A complex sewer line clearance with a camera might be $800-$2,000. The plumber should provide a clear estimate before starting work.
How to Get an Emergency Plumber and What to Do Until They Arrive
When disaster hits, stay calm and follow these steps:
- Shut Off the Water: Know where your main water shut-off valve is. It’s often in the basement, crawlspace, or near the water meter. Turn it clockwise to stop all water flow into the house.
- Shut Off the Water Heater: If the leak is major, turn the power (breaker) or gas supply to your water heater off to prevent damage.
- Contain the Leak: Use buckets, towels, and mops to minimize water spread.

- Clear a Path: Move furniture and rugs away from the area so the plumber has easy access.
- Document the Damage: Take photos for your insurance company.
For sewer backups, avoid using any sinks, toilets, or showers. For suspected gas leaks, do not use any electrical switches, phones, or open flames—just evacuate and call from outside.
Local Factors That Affect Your Plumbing in Woodstock, CT
Our beautiful New England town has unique plumbing needs.
- Climate: Our cold winters are the #1 cause of burst pipes. Summer humidity can cause condensation and sweating pipes. Proper insulation is key.
- Housing Stock: Older neighborhoods with charming historic homes often have outdated plumbing like galvanized steel pipes that corrode from the inside out, leading to low water pressure and sudden failures.
- Water Source: Many homes use well water, which can be hard. This leads to mineral buildup that clogs pipes and fixtures over time.
- Septic Systems: In more rural parts of Woodstock, failing septic systems or drain fields saturated by spring thaw are common emergencies.
